Output 65e0fa0c434dc967631b30c4a7e3d65f6b3441ba5ba25de2e0e19f3fcd212856:0

value
26450
script pubkey
OP_0 OP_PUSHBYTES_20 2462a24179d6320181601fe32f17d1e5ae0054e1
address
bc1qy332yste6ceqrqtqrl3j7973ukhqq48p90davq
transaction
65e0fa0c434dc967631b30c4a7e3d65f6b3441ba5ba25de2e0e19f3fcd212856
spent
true